This weeks Forget Me Not is your important numbers and contact information.

Just in case there is a need, it is a good idea to have a list of important numbers, and contact information.
This could come in handy for many situations. Such as medical emergencies, or being a dock runner that happens to be just a few minutes late, and misses the boat. Or even the 'did I forget to turn the stove off' incidents. It is better to have them, and not need them, than to need them, and not have them.
You may also want the contact information list to send post cards to your friends back home. Did you know that there is a post office on Castaway Cay, Disney's private island? It is to bad that we won't have a chance to stop there on this cruise. That is one of our favorite places to mail our Christmas cards from on a fall cruise. If you would like Disney to mail your post cards from Castaway, you can take them to Guest Services and pay for their Bahamian postage, and ask that the next time the boat is docked at Castaway that they be mailed from the post office on the island.
Either way, this simple sheet of paper that will not bog your luggage down may come in quite handy.

When you receive your cruise document book a few weeks before sailing, there will be cards with ship contact information on it for you to give to anyone who may need to reach you in case of emergency or such. These cards work best when given to those who may need to contact you, not left sitting on the kitchen counter and then explained and described to the person you were going to give them to (chalk that one up to a Tink Moment!)

Today's Forget Me Not is a reminder for your carry on bag. Not your whole carry on bag, just a small part of it, or one small bag separate from the sunscreen, the swimsuits (for those brave souls who will be taking an ice plunge), and from the bottles of wine. This is a reminder to pack casual dinner wear in your carry on for that evenings dinner just in case your luggage does not make it to your cabin in time for your dinner seating.

The cast members will do their very best to get each cabin its luggage before you have to head to dinner, but there are a few factors that slow this process down.

* First, they can only deliver luggage that the port authority
has already cleared and loaded on to the boat.
* Second, remember, that people can arrive as late as
2:30 - 3:00, which is only 2 1/2 hours before dinner. Which
means their luggage still has to clear the port authority,
and find its way to their floor after they board.
* Third there could be up to 2,700 passengers on the boat
who each are allowed to check 2 bags in. That is a
possible, 5,400 pieces of luggage that have to navigate
the narrow corridors of the boat to find their home away
from home.
* And fourth each cabin steward only has 2 hands.

So, it is understandable that your luggage may take a little longer to find its way to your cabin than it will for dinner time to arrive. But if you remember to pack your casual dinner clothes in your carry on, you will not have to worry. You will be all set to go.

What we have found that works well for this is packing cubes, one for each person. If you are in a small group, say of 2 like my traveling party this time around, you can probably find room for the cubes in another bag, or put the 2 in a small bag that can be tucked away in a larger carry on. However, if you are in a larger group of say 5 or 6, and each person has their own cube, having one bag dedicated to the packing cubes would work best. We would then have one of the adults take care of that carry on. Then, come dinner time, we were ready to go whether the luggage made it or not. This gave us one other advantage. if the luggage did make it, we did not have to hurry and unpack to try to find the clothes for that evenings dinner.
